Description

Assist in the promotion a proactive Health and Safety culture throughout the Trust in order to assist in the reduction of incidents, accidents and near miss events. Provide the highest standard of professional health and safety advice and training to Trust staff, (in line with CSTF requirements where applicable), in supporting the management of non-clinical risks and promoting use of safe working practices throughout the Trust. To promote the Trusts values in creating a safe and secure environment in which to deliver the highest standards of clinical care to the Trusts patients. The post holder will predominately provide specialist advice and guidance to all Trust employees, but they will also be expected to advise on patient related accidents, injuries and clinical environments on safety matters.
They will also be responsible for;Auditing and writing reports Managing Datix and investigating incidents, accidents and near miss events Managing the online COSHH database Health and Safety Training Policy Writing and Updating Providing specialist advice and guidance on health and safety issues Advise staff regarding suitable safety equipment and carry out safety risk assessments.
